  Cross River Puffer T. Pustulatus 12-14inch 500£


Description: A highly sort after rare species of freshwater pufferfish originating from central Africa. The distinct red spots of the Cross River Puffer make this an attractive personable fish. The species is highly aggressive and best kept alone. Due to the scarcity of this fish it is best kept by experts.

Species Cross River Puffer T. Pustulatus
Current Size 12inch
Temperature Range . 24-28
pH Range 6.4-6.8
Temperament Aggressive
Care Requirements A highly sort after rare species of freshwater pufferfish originating from central Africa. The species is highly aggressive and best kept alone. With it powerful beak it is able to crush snail and shrimp with ease. A diet of frozen lance fish and frozen shrimp is well suited to this larger fish. Due to the scarcity of this fish it is best kept by experts.
